Understanding Mobile Home Insurance
Mobile home insurance is designed to protect your home, personal belongings, and liability against various risks. Unlike traditional homeowners insurance, mobile home insurance caters specifically to the unique needs of mobile or manufactured homes. According to the National Association of Insurance Commissioners (NAIC), mobile home insurance is essential for protecting these types of dwellings, which are often more vulnerable to certain risks.
Why Do You Need Mobile Home Insurance?
Many people underestimate the importance of having insurance for their mobile homes. Here are a few compelling reasons why you should consider it:
- Protection Against Natural Disasters: Mobile homes are particularly susceptible to severe weather conditions, including hurricanes, tornadoes, and floods. Having insurance can provide peace of mind knowing that your home is protected.
- Liability Coverage: If someone is injured on your property, you could be held liable. Mobile home insurance typically includes liability coverage, which can help protect your finances.
- Coverage for Personal Belongings: From furniture to electronics, your personal belongings are at risk. Mobile home insurance can cover the loss or damage of these items due to theft, fire, or other disasters.
- Financing Requirements: If you plan to finance your mobile home, lenders often require insurance. This protects their investment and ensures you can repay your loan.

Exploring Your Mobile Home Insurance Options
As I researched mobile home insurance, I discovered several options tailored to different needs. Here’s a breakdown of what you can find:
1. Comprehensive Coverage
Comprehensive coverage is the most extensive form of mobile home insurance. It typically covers:
- Damage to your mobile home from natural disasters
- Theft of personal belongings
- Liability protection in case of injury on your property
- Additional living expenses if you need to live elsewhere during repairs
2. Named Perils Coverage
This type of policy only covers specific risks that are explicitly mentioned in the policy. Common named perils include:
- Fire
- Windstorm
- Vandalism
This option can be more affordable but may leave you vulnerable to other risks not covered in the policy.
3. Liability Coverage
Liability coverage protects you from legal claims if someone is injured on your property. This is vital for mobile homeowners who frequently have guests or visitors.
How to Get a Free Quote for Mobile Home Insurance
Getting a quote for mobile home insurance doesn’t have to be a daunting task. Here’s a step-by-step process I found useful:
1. Gather Information
Before reaching out to insurance providers, gather essential information, including:
- The age and make of your mobile home
- Your location and any nearby hazards
- Details about any upgrades or safety features
- Your estimated personal property value
2. Compare Multiple Quotes
Don’t settle for the first quote you receive. Use online tools to compare rates from different providers. Websites like Insure.com allow you to compare multiple quotes quickly.
3. Ask About Discounts
Insurance companies often offer discounts. Here are a few common ones:
- Bundling policies (like auto and home insurance)
- Installing safety features (like smoke detectors and security systems)
- Being claims-free for a certain period
4. Review the Policy Thoroughly
Once you receive quotes, take the time to read through each policy carefully. Look for:
- Coverage limits
- Exclusions
- Deductibles
Understanding these details will help you make an informed decision.
Common Misconceptions About Mobile Home Insurance
As I dug deeper into mobile home insurance, I encountered several misconceptions that can mislead potential buyers. Let’s debunk some of these myths:
Myth 1: Mobile Homes Are Not Insurable
Many people believe that mobile homes cannot be insured. In reality, numerous insurance companies offer specialized policies for mobile homes, making them insurable just like traditional homes.
Myth 2: Mobile Home Insurance is Too Expensive
While costs can vary, mobile home insurance can be quite affordable, especially when you shop around and look for discounts. In fact, the average cost for mobile home insurance ranges from $300 to $1,000 annually, depending on various factors.
Myth 3: All Policies Are the Same
Not all mobile home insurance policies are created equal. It’s crucial to compare different policies and understand their coverage options, limits, and exclusions. Doing your research can lead to finding a policy that best suits your needs.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. What is the average cost of mobile home insurance?
The average cost can range from $300 to $1,000 per year, depending on various factors including location, home value, and coverage options.
2. Is mobile home insurance required?
While it isn’t legally required, many lenders require mobile home insurance to secure financing.
3. Can I get mobile home insurance if my home is older?
Yes, many insurance companies offer coverage for older mobile homes, but coverage options may vary.
4. What should I do if I need to file a claim?
Contact your insurance provider as soon as possible, document the damage, and provide any necessary information they request to process your claim.
